Bronze for Jazz and Concert Bands at KBB Festival

Senior Jazz and Concert Bands earn bronze at the KBB Music Festival in Parnell, Auckland.

Four Orewa College bands performed at one of Auckland’s top music events

Orewa College musicians impressed at the KBB Music Festival in Parnell this August, with the Senior Jazz and Concert Bands both earning bronze awards.

Held at one of Auckland’s top venues for secondary school ensembles, the festival featured performances from four Orewa College groups: Symphonic, Concert, Senior Jazz, and Junior Jazz.

On 12 August, the Jazz Bands performed, followed by the Symphonic and Concert Bands on 15 August. Mr Wilkin led the Symphonic and Senior Jazz Bands, Mr Popper conducted the Concert Band, and Il’ya Allen directed Junior Jazz.

“Our goal for the festival was to display true musicianship while also showing compassion in our own playing as well as the other bands in our session,” said Mr Wilkin. “I believe we achieved this in flying colors!”

Each group delivered carefully rehearsed pieces, showcasing weeks of dedication and teamwork. This experience not only celebrated musicianship but also gave students the added prestige of a bronze finish.
